1. (The major one!) I think this may have been touched on in other forum posts. MW2010 (even latest 1.0.15) seems to randomly stop responding for a few seconds. I've seen this when doing the following:
  • Clicking a delete icon on a message.
    Using up/down cursor to move up/down the list.
    Clicking the Check Mail button.
    Moving to a different Inbox/Recycle Bin/Settings tab.
The delay is often up to 4 or 5 seconds before the program responds. The PC spec is XP SP3, Intel Dual core, 3GB memory. No other programs experience this when using the same loads as when MW is running (when it DOES experience this). I have checked CPU and memory usage on the PC when it happens and it doesn't appear to be related to this (i.e. it can occur when the CPU usage is low and there is plenty of free memory).

Occurence seems random though is worse when MW is checking my accounts. Often there will be several lock-ups over a several seconds/operations.

I subscribe to a few of the freecycle/cheapcycle Yahoo groups here in the UK and have set up a filter which I then use (via the status grouping) to group these together. The filter has 2 rules: one looking for cheapcycle and the other looking for freegle (the local version of freecycle) in the subject line. However, some emails escape the filtering. When I looked at these via the source option I could see that they had some extra information in the Subject: line. For example, a "good" email (which correctly gets filtered) will look like this:
Subject: [cheapcyclenorfolk] for sale swing crib nr3 area
And a "bad" one (which consistently fails to get picked up by the filter) can look like the following:
Subject: [cheapcyclenorfolk] =?ISO-8859-1?Q?for=20sale=20cover=20n=20play=20bouncer=20=A310=20gty?=
=?ISO-8859-1?Q?armouth?=
This particular one gets split over two lines in the source view (though that may not be relevant). The cheapcycle part of the subject isn't actually broken up in any way so I'm not sure why the filter is ignoring it. I haven't noticed this problem with emails other than those from the freecycle/cheapcycle Yahoo groups.
